  16. I think there are several major roadblocks to a switch of focus working: - BZPower has been known as an exclusively Bionicle website for over ten years. To change that perception now would be very difficult. - In the cases of Ninjago and Hero Factory, the time to attract all the new fans has passed as the lines are now established. - Bionicle had an extensive storyline and complex universe that provided a rich source of discussion. Current themes have moved away from that setup to focus on action and comedy, leaving little potential for discussion. - Bionicle was a constraction line whereas Ninjago and Chima are System-based. Very few FOLs like both, which would lead to a division among MOCers. If this site wasn't focused around bionicle, then there would be nowhere for many fans to go. I would feel a little annoyed, as I am not fond of HF or Ninjago, and this site is the only real fanbase left. It's a little sad. If lego brought bionicle back, but with more advanced sets, like the earlier ones, this site would be popular again no doubt.
